#0fb4c8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0fb4c8 is composed of 5.9% red, 70.6%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.5% cyan, 10%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 186.5 degrees, a saturation of 86% and a lightness of 42.2%. #0fb4c8 color hex could be obtained by blending #1effff with #006991.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

#0fb4c8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0fb4c8 has RGB values of R:15, G:180,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0.1,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 1029320.
